Corus, British Triathlon's premier sponsor, is to launch the 2008 Corus Elite Series with the first race taking place at GreenPark in Reading, on 18 May.
In its second year, the three race triathlon competition will play an important role in the preparation of British triathletes hoping to compete at the Beijing Olympic Games later this year, as well as providing an opportunity for developing talent to gain vital experience against the World's best triathletes on home soil. With strong medal hopes and recent international success in both the men's and women's fields, the elite events offer an opportunity for a UK audience to experience top level racing, generating excitement across the summer. Green Park is the ideal setting for an elite triathlon as Longwater Lake, running through the centre of the Park, will be used for the swim and the surrounding closed roads for the bike and running legs.
The course will challenge the 50 strong men's and women's fields. The 750m swim in Longwater Lake includes a straight swim down the lake consisting of an exciting run out and dive back in at 300m. The 20km cycle leg will take participants out and around the spectator friendly closed roads of the office park before the triathletes transition into a speedy three lap 5km run to race to the finish.
There is also a novice's triathlon which will consist of 300m swim, then a 8k cycle race, then 1.8km run over the same circuit.
